What is AI Web Scraping?
AI web scraping combines natural language processing, computer vision, and machine learning to intelligently extract data from web pages. Unlike traditional scraping that relies on fixed selectors and scripts, AI-driven approaches adapt to complex site structures, dynamic content, and automatic site changes, improving accuracy and reducing maintenance.
How Does AI Web Scraping Work?
Users provide URLs or natural-language prompts. The system visually analyzes page elements, detects relevant data such as tables, text blocks, images, or prices, then extracts and formats that data into structured outputs (JSON, CSV, database records). Advanced solutions support JavaScript rendering, CAPTCHA handling, proxy rotation, and session management to handle modern, dynamic sites.
Key Benefits of AI Web Scraping Tools
- Time efficiency: rapid setup with no-code interfaces and auto-detection.
- Adaptability: copes with dynamic and JavaScript-heavy websites.
- Accessibility: enables non-technical users to collect structured data.
- Scalability: supports projects from small experiments to enterprise workloads.
Top Use Cases for AI Web Scraping
- E-commerce: price comparison, inventory and product monitoring.
- Lead generation: extract contacts, company details, and firmographics.
- Market research: aggregate reviews, sentiment, and competitor signals.
- Content aggregation: collect news, reviews, and social insights.
- Real estate: property listings, historical pricing, and neighborhood data.
Essential Features in AI Web Scraping Tools
- No-code visual interfaces and natural-language prompts.
- Support for dynamic content and JavaScript rendering.
- Anti-bot strategies (proxy rotation, CAPTCHA handling, fingerprint mitigation).
- Flexible export options (API endpoints, JSON, CSV, database connectors).
- Scheduling, monitoring, and integrations with spreadsheet and workflow automation services.
- Error handling, retry logic, and performance analytics.
How to Choose the Best AI Web Scraping Solution
Evaluate based on technical comfort, data volume needs, budget, and required integrations. Beginners often prefer visual editors and templates; developers may favor API-first platforms that support custom workflows. Consider pricing models (per-task, subscription, or credits), scalability, and the ease of integrating results into your data stack.
Free vs Paid Options
Free tiers are useful for evaluation and small projects but typically limit volume and features. Paid plans unlock higher throughput, advanced AI capabilities, proxy pools, and dedicated support.
Common Limitations and How to Overcome Them
- Legal and ethical considerations: comply with website terms, privacy laws, and robots directives.
- Complex site layouts and frequent UI changes: test on representative pages and use tools with adaptive selectors.
- Anti-bot measures: rely on ethically configured proxy rotation, session management, and CAPTCHA handling when permitted.
- Accuracy validation: start with small datasets, sample results, and adjust extraction rules regularly.
Best Types of Solutions for Different Users
- No-code visual platforms: easy entry for beginners and marketers; rapid setup for specific tasks.
- API-first and customizable platforms: best for developers and enterprise integrations; support complex workflows and scale.
- Hybrid services and managed offerings: combine automation with human-in-the-loop validation for high-value or sensitive data.
| Solution Type | Typical Pricing | Key Features | Best For |
|---|---|---|---|
| No-code visual platforms | Free/Paid tiers | Visual editors, templates, automation | Non-technical users, marketers |
| API-first platforms | Subscription/usage | Custom workflows, programmatic access | Developers, enterprise projects |
| Hybrid / managed services | Paid / per-project | Human validation, SLA, scale | High-value scraping, regulated use cases |
Frequently Asked Questions (FAQs)
What is the best free AI web scraper?
There is no single "best" free option for everyone. Choose a free-tier solution that supports JavaScript rendering, provides basic proxy access, allows exports in formats you need, and has a usable interface for your skill level. Expect limitations on volume, concurrency, and advanced anti-bot features in free plans.
Is AI web scraping legal and ethical?
Legality depends on jurisdiction, the target site's terms of service, and the nature of the data. Scraping publicly available information is often permitted, but collecting personal data, copyrighted content, or ignoring explicit site restrictions can create legal and privacy risks. Follow robots directives where appropriate, respect rate limits, avoid harvesting sensitive personal data, and consult legal counsel for large-scale or high-risk projects.
Can AI scrapers handle JavaScript-heavy sites?
Yes—when the solution supports JavaScript rendering via headless browsers or server-side rendering techniques. Rendering dynamic pages requires more resources and can be slower; efficient tools use techniques like selective rendering, API inspection, or network replay to improve performance and reliability.
How do AI scrapers handle anti-bot measures?
Common, ethically applied techniques include rotating proxies and IP pools, managing cookies and sessions, mimicking realistic browser behavior, pacing requests, and integrating CAPTCHA resolution services when permitted. Note that attempting to circumvent explicit security measures can be legally risky and unethical—use such features responsibly and in compliance with applicable rules.
What data export formats are common?
Common formats and integration methods include JSON, CSV, Excel, XML, direct database writes, webhooks, and programmatic APIs. Many platforms also offer scheduled exports or connectors to spreadsheet and workflow automation services for downstream processing.
Use the criteria and feature checklist above to evaluate solutions that match your technical skill, data needs, and budget. Begin with a small pilot to validate accuracy and compliance before scaling.